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
Cookies:
4 sticks butter

6 oz cream cheese

1 1/2 c sugar

1/2 tsp salt

2 tsp vanilla

2 eggs

6 cups of flour.

Icing:

4 cups powdered sugar, 1 1/2 tsp cream of tartar, 3 tbsp meringue powder 6-8 Tbsp warm water.

Directions:
Directions:
Mix together softened butter and cream cheese. Add 1 1/2 c sugar, beating till fluffy. Add 2 tsp vanilla and 2 eggs, one at a time. Add flour, 1 cup at a time to make a stiff dough.

Divide dough into 3 discs. Wrap in plastic. Chill 2-3 hours.

Roll out on floured surface to about 1/4 to 3/8" thick. Cut into shapes as desired.

Bake in 375º preheated oven for 8:40 to 8;50 minutes (don't let edges brown). Cool on wire racks.

Ice cookies:

Beat all ingredients together. Make icing stiff to begin with to use as outline for the icing filling. Once you've outlined the cookies, think icing to 'flood' insides of cookies.
